William Eugene "Bill" Kelley

November 9, 1929 — June 8, 2010

Mr. William Eugene "Bill" Kelley, 80, self-employed painter, died Tuesday, June 8, 2010 at his residence on Mooresville Pike surrounded by his loving family. Funeral services will be conducted Saturday at 3:00 p.m. at Oakes & Nichols with Jeff Cates officiating. Burial will follow in Pleasant Mount Cemetery. The family will visit with friends Friday from 4:00 to 8:00 p.m. and after 1:00 p.m. Saturday at the funeral home. Notes of sympathy may be sent to www.oakesandnichols.com. The Maury County native was the son of the late English Kelley and Ophelia Davis Kelley. Survivors include 4 daughters, Teresa (Terry) Bowman of Culleoka, Janice (Johnny) Scroggins of Culleoka, Linda (Donnie) King of Pulaski, and Pam Wells of Pulaski; 4 sons, William "Bill" (Vickie) Kelley of Columbia, William Carroll Kelley of Clifton, Wayne (Shannon) Kelley of Flint, Michigan, and Wade (Priscilla Anderson) Kelley; 2 sisters, Norene Eldridge and Rachel Cummins of Culleoka; numerous grandchildren and great-grandchildren. He was preceded in death by his wife, Elizabeth Stewart Kelley; and a daughter, Christy Diane Kelley. Active pallbearers are Terry Bowman,Sr. Ken Brown, Terry Bowman, Jr., Ryan Alred, B. J. Robertson, and Douglas Wade Kelley. Honorary pallbearers include Jack Auville, Billy Clyde Foster, Ray Morrow, and staff of S & K Market.
